Season 1

Fukagawa / Tokyo
Episode 1 of the new season takes place in Fukagawa, Tokyo where Basho wrote many of his famous haiku poems. Special guest Hideho Kindaichi, a revered linguistic scholar, along with our Haiku Masters Michio Nakahara and Kit Pancoast Nagamura take you on a journey through the world of Photo Haiku at the beautiful Tomioka Hachimangu Shrine.

Matsuyama / Ehime
Episode 3 takes place at Dogo Onsen, one of the oldest hot springs in Japan going back 1300 years, in Matsuyama City, Ehime Prefecture, which is known for its rich literary culture and for producing many haiku poets. Haiku is part of the fabric of Matsuyama with Haiku Posts installed throughout the city for people to submit their haiku. Episode 3 will seek to explore the history and culture of Matsuyama with the guest of the month, Noriko Kan, lecturer, Matsuyama University.

Matsuyama / Ehime
Episode 4 of HAIKU MASTERS takes place in Matsuyama city with world-renowned cellist, Mr. Nathaniel Rosen, who joins us at Taisanji Temple, one of the 88 temples of the Ohenro pilgrimage.

Nikko / Tochigi
Episode 5 takes place in the city of Nikko, one of the most popular tourist destinations in Japan, located just north of Tokyo. We hope you enjoy the beautiful sceneries of Nikko Toshogu Shrine,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, with our Haiku Masters and our guest, Uruma Takezawa, a photographer who has traveled over 103 countries.

Kurobane / Tochigi
Episode 6 takes place in Kurobane, Tochigi Prefecture, a place where Basho stayed the longest to take refuge and to ponder the journey ahead while on his Okuno Hosomichi trail. The guest for this episode is Ms. Barbara S. Morrison, associate professor of the International Department at Utsunomiya University.

Rikugien Gardens / Tokyo
Episode 7 takes place in Rikugien Gardens in Tokyo which was constructed 300 years ago over a period of 7 years. Rikugien means Garden of the Six Principles of Poetry as its aesthetics are rooted in the world of Waka poetry. Our guest for this episode is photographer Lisa Vogt who has traveled over 50 countries around the world.

Embassy of Sweden / Tokyo
This episode’s featured guest is Mr. Kai Falkman, Ambassador and the Honorary President of the Swedish Haiku Society. A haiku poet himself, Mr. Falkman will talk about the photo haiku submissions. The episode was filmed at the Embassy of Sweden in Tokyo.
